Job summary

Quest Global is seeking a Naval Architect to support dockyard operations and ship/marine system design. You will work with the Naval Architecture team and customers to develop capabilities and deliver technical documentation for safe operation of vessels and marine assets.

The role requires a Bachelor’s degree in Naval Architecture or Marine Engineering, understanding of stability and marine systems, and familiarity with CAD tools such as AutoCAD, Orca3D, Optimoor and GHS.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Naval Architecture, Marine Engineering or closely related discipline.
  • Understanding of ship stability, structural behaviour and marine systems.
  • Awareness of dockyard operations, vessel servicing and floating infrastructure.
  • Familiarity with classification rules and regulatory frameworks (e.g. Lloyd’s Register).
  • Ability to interpret and produce technical drawings, reports and engineering calculations.
  • Familiarity with CAD software and structural/hydrostatic analysis tools.
  • Good written and verbal communication skills and collaborative work style.

Responsibilities

  • Support naval architecture analyses including mooring, stability, towing and structural assessments.
  • Assist design, modification and development projects for dockyard operations and safety.
  • Carry out on-site surveys and inspections of vessels and marine assets.
  • Ensure compliance with marine classification and regulatory requirements.
  • Prepare clear technical reports, calculations and documentation.
  • Collaborate with multi-disciplinary teams across engineering disciplines.
  • Adapt to evolving project needs balancing time, cost and quality.
